SquatSentry builds are reproducible from tagged commits only. Verify the scanner's ruleset hash matches the manifest before promoting. Never promote an artifact lacking a signed attestation from the Fenwick build farm. If provenance checks fail, roll back and page the pipeline owner. For audits, cite the attestation token below.

build token for kagaf-hahof: htk14_9d3d4d26d7d8de

Welcome to the Stockline team at Verrow Goods. The nightly inventory reconciliation job (recon-sync) compares warehouse counts against the ledger in Tallyvault. It runs at 02:00 and alerts #stockline-ops on mismatch. If the job's service account locks out after three failed syncs, you must unseal it manually. Do not restart the worker first. Unsealing requires the recovery passphrase, which is as follows.

unlock words, yawig-kagef: gordor-holvan-ulaael-pramir-ulaiel-tamdor

Ticket #88: Badge system migration, night-shift notice. Over the weekend, Fenwick Row is moving from the old Keystone readers to the new Ardale panels. Night staff should expect the lift lobby readers to be offline between 01:00 and 04:00 on Saturday. During this window, use the stairwell doors only, and log every entry in the paper register at the guard desk. Legacy badges will stop working once the cutover completes. Until your replacement badge arrives, the night crew should use the interim code below.

door code, yageg-yagap: bdg-DNN-9